Life Detection Centennial Challenge RFI

NASA is seeking input on a life detection Centennial Challenge proposed to start in 2017. The challenge focuses on building and demonstrating a scientific instrument capable of detecting evidence of Earth-type life in a small (10 mL) liquid sample provided to the instrument. Comments must be submitted in electronic form no later than 11:59 pm Eastern Time on January 27, 2017, to Ms. Monsi Roman at HQ-STMD-CentennialChallenges@mail.nasa.gov.
